My Research

The focus of my research is the understanding of the physical mechanisms responsible for the transfer and emplacement of magma in the Earth’s crust and its eruption at the surface.
Our scientific mission is to understand how magmatic processes contribute to shaping our planet and what are the main physical factors controlling the frequency and magnitude of volcanic eruptions and the formation of magmatic ore deposits.
